CVE-2026-73318
XenForo before 2.3.13 contains a missing authorization vulnerability in the force-agreement controller that allows any ACP administrator to access and submit force-agreement forms regardless of their assigned permissions. Attackers can bypass the option permission declared in the navigation configuration to update the global policy last-updated timestamp, forcing all users to re-agree to the privacy policy or terms of service.
